#!/usr/bin/env python
#----------------------------------------------------------------------
import sys, os, string
from distutils.core import setup, Extension
from distutils.file_util import copy_file
from distutils.dir_util import mkpath
from distutils.dep_util import newer
from my_distutils import run_swig, contrib_copy_tree
#----------------------------------------------------------------------
# flags and values that affect this script
#----------------------------------------------------------------------
VERSION = "2.2.2"
DESCRIPTION = "Cross platform GUI toolkit for Python"
AUTHOR = "Robin Dunn"
AUTHOR_EMAIL = "robin@alldunn.com"
URL = "http://wxPython.org/"
LICENCE = "wxWindows (LGPL derivative)"
LONG_DESCRIPTION = """\
wxPython is a GUI toolkit for Python that is a wrapper around the
wxWindows C++ GUI library. wxPython provides a large variety of
window types and controls, all imlemented with a native look and
feel (and runtime speed) on the platforms it is supported on.
"""
BUILD_GLCANVAS = 1 # If true, build the contrib/glcanvas extension module
BUILD_OGL = 1 # If true, build the contrib/ogl extension module
BUILD_STC = 1 # If true, build the contrib/stc extension module
USE_SWIG = 0 # Should we actually execute SWIG, or just use the
# files already in the distribution?
IN_CVS_TREE = 0 # Set to true if building in a full wxWindows CVS
# tree, otherwise will assume all needed files are
# available in the wxPython source distribution
# Some MSW build settings
FINAL = 1 # Mirrors use of same flag in wx makefiles,
# (0 or 1 only) should probably find a way to
# autodetect this...
HYBRID = 0 # If set and not debug or FINAL, then build a
# hybrid extension that can be used by the
# non-debug version of python, but contains
# debugging symbols for wxWindows and wxPython.
# wxWindows must have been built with /MD, not /MDd
# (using FINAL=hybrid will do it.)
WXDLLVER = '22_2' # Version part of DLL name
#----------------------------------------------------------------------
# Some other globals
#----------------------------------------------------------------------
PKGDIR = 'wxPython'
wxpExtensions = []
force = '--force' in sys.argv or '-f' in sys.argv
debug = '--debug' in sys.argv or '-g' in sys.argv
#----------------------------------------------------------------------
# Check for build flags on the command line
#----------------------------------------------------------------------
for flag in ['BUILD_GLCANVAS', 'BUILD_OGL', 'BUILD_STC',
'USE_SWIG', 'IN_CVS_TREE', 'FINAL', 'HYBRID',
'WXDLLVER', ]:
for x in range(len(sys.argv)):
if string.find(sys.argv[x], flag) == 0:
pos = string.find(sys.argv[x], '=') + 1
if pos > 0:
vars()[flag] = eval(sys.argv[x][pos:])
sys.argv[x] = ''
sys.argv = filter(None, sys.argv)
#----------------------------------------------------------------------
# Setup some platform specific stuff
#----------------------------------------------------------------------
if os.name == 'nt':
# Set compile flags and such for MSVC. These values are derived
# from the wxWindows makefiles for MSVC, others will probably
# vary...
WXDIR = os.environ['WXWIN']
WXPLAT = '__WXMSW__'
GENDIR = 'msw'
if debug:
FINAL = 0
HYBRID = 0
if HYBRID:
FINAL = 0
includes = ['src',
os.path.join(WXDIR, 'include'),
]
defines = [ ('WIN32', None), # Some of these are no longer
('__WIN32__', None), # necessary. Anybody know which?
('_WINDOWS', None),
('__WINDOWS__', None),
('WINVER', '0x0400'),
('__WIN95__', None),
('STRICT', None),
(WXPLAT, None),
('WXUSINGDLL', '1'),
('SWIG_GLOBAL', None),
('HAVE_CONFIG_H', None),
('WXP_USE_THREAD', '1'),
]
if not FINAL or HYBRID:
defines.append( ('__WXDEBUG__', None) )
libdirs = [os.path.join(WXDIR, 'lib'), 'build\\ilib']
if FINAL:
wxdll = 'wx' + WXDLLVER
elif HYBRID:
wxdll = 'wx' + WXDLLVER + 'h'
else:
wxdll = 'wx' + WXDLLVER + 'd'
libs = [wxdll, 'kernel32', 'user32', 'gdi32', 'comdlg32',
'winspool', 'winmm', 'shell32', 'oldnames', 'comctl32',
'ctl3d32', 'odbc32', 'ole32', 'oleaut32', 'uuid', 'rpcrt4',
'advapi32', 'wsock32']
cflags = None
lflags = None
if not FINAL and HYBRID:
cflags = ['/Od', '/Z7']
lflags = ['/DEBUG', ] ## '/PDB:NONE']
elif os.name == 'posix':
# Set flags for Unix type platforms
WXDIR = '..' # assumes IN_CVS_TREE
WXPLAT = '__WXGTK__' # and assumes GTK...
GENDIR = 'gtk' # Need to allow for Motif eventually too
includes = ['src']
defines = [('SWIG_GLOBAL', None),
('HAVE_CONFIG_H', None),
('WXP_USE_THREAD', '1'),
]
libdirs = []
libs = []
cflags = os.popen('wx-config --cflags', 'r').read()[:-1] + ' ' + \
os.popen('gtk-config --cflags', 'r').read()[:-1]
cflags = string.split(cflags)
lflags = os.popen('wx-config --libs', 'r').read()[:-1] + ' ' + \
os.popen('gtk-config --libs', 'r').read()[:-1]
lflags = string.split(lflags)
else:
raise 'Sorry Charlie...'
